Baltimore, Maryland, The University of Maryland Baltimore County (UMBC) is seeking an Associate Athletic Trainer to join the Department of Athletics, Sports Medicine and Performance. This individual will report to the Associate Athletic Director for Sports Medicine and Performance. The Associate Athletic Trainer will play a key role in providing comprehensive athletic training services to NCAA Division I student-athletes. Responsibilities include assessing injuries, developing treatment plans, conducting rehabilitation programs, and coordinating with physicians, coaches, sports performance staff, and other healthcare professionals to ensure the overall health, safety, and performance of student-athletes. The ideal candidate will possess strong communication and interpersonal skills, as well as the ability to work collaboratively in a dynamic team environment. This position offers a unique opportunity to work closely with talented student-athletes and contribute to their athletic success and well-being. Bachelor's degree in Athletic Training or related field Current certification by the Board of Certification (BOC) for Athletic Trainers Current CPR/AED certification Minimum of 2 years of experience working as an athletic trainer with collegiate athletes Knowledge of NCAA rules and regulations regarding student-athlete health and safety Strong organizational skills and attention to detail Benefits: UMBC offers a rich benefits package. Regular and grant funded regular positions (Full benefits summary click here): Generous Leave which includes accruing: 22 Days of Annual Leave 15 Days of Sick Leave 15 Holidays 3 Personal Days Tuition Remission: 8 credit hours per semester Tuition remission at UMBC for eligible dependents after two years of FT employment Additional Benefits: Life and disability insurance Retirement plans (including the choice of joining the pension plan) Professional development opportunities Wellness opportunities & Much more
